Output 798374127597df3a5a213220b291518cf348f41e1b946b4b8a51789aebf32ded:27

value
56846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758450cd886543968f45139a5d230f51763638cf OP_EQUAL
address
3CQPVSSgp6nKzQd7ZK2yRTqp545SCFbvpY
transaction
798374127597df3a5a213220b291518cf348f41e1b946b4b8a51789aebf32ded
confirmations
225086
spent
true